Project

General

Profile

Bug #185 » 0044-gettext.m4-Update-to-serial-79.patch

Marko Lindqvist, 01/18/2024 09:41 PM

View differences:

m4/gettext.m4
# gettext.m4 serial 78 (gettext-0.22.4)
dnl Copyright (C) 1995-2014, 2016, 2018-2023 Free Software Foundation, Inc.
# gettext.m4 serial 79 (gettext-0.23)
dnl Copyright (C) 1995-2014, 2016, 2018-2024 Free Software Foundation, Inc.
dnl This file is free software; the Free Software Foundation
dnl gives unlimited permission to copy and/or distribute it,
dnl with or without modifications, as long as this notice is preserved.
......
AC_LIB_LINKFLAGS_BODY([intl])
AC_CACHE_CHECK([for GNU gettext in libintl],
[$gt_func_gnugettext_libintl],
[gt_save_CPPFLAGS="$CPPFLAGS"
[gt_saved_CPPFLAGS="$CPPFLAGS"
CPPFLAGS="$CPPFLAGS $INCINTL"
gt_save_LIBS="$LIBS"
gt_saved_LIBS="$LIBS"
LIBS="$LIBS $LIBINTL"
dnl Now see whether libintl exists and does not depend on libiconv.
AC_LINK_IFELSE(
......
eval "$gt_func_gnugettext_libintl=yes"
])
fi
CPPFLAGS="$gt_save_CPPFLAGS"
LIBS="$gt_save_LIBS"])
CPPFLAGS="$gt_saved_CPPFLAGS"
LIBS="$gt_saved_LIBS"])
fi
dnl If an already present or preinstalled GNU gettext() is found,
......
dnl Define localedir_c and localedir_c_make.
dnl Find the final value of localedir.
gt_save_prefix="${prefix}"
gt_save_datarootdir="${datarootdir}"
gt_save_localedir="${localedir}"
gt_saved_prefix="${prefix}"
gt_saved_datarootdir="${datarootdir}"
gt_saved_localedir="${localedir}"
dnl Unfortunately, prefix gets only finally determined at the end of
dnl configure.
if test "X$prefix" = "XNONE"; then
......
eval datarootdir="$datarootdir"
eval localedir="$localedir"
gl_BUILD_TO_HOST([localedir])
localedir="${gt_save_localedir}"
datarootdir="${gt_save_datarootdir}"
prefix="${gt_save_prefix}"
localedir="${gt_saved_localedir}"
datarootdir="${gt_saved_datarootdir}"
prefix="${gt_saved_prefix}"
])
(1-1/2)